Galvanization is a process that involves applying a protective zinc coating to steel or iron to prevent rusting. This process significantly increases the lifespan of metal components, making them ideal for use in harsh environments where moisture and oxidization pose a threat. For washers, a component that plays a critical role in distributing load and preventing wear at the connection points of fasteners, galvanization is particularly beneficial. It ensures that the structural components remain intact under strenuous conditions, offering long-lasting reliability.
Professionals in construction and repair often select galvanized washers for their exceptional resistance to corrosive elements. In industries such as marine construction, where exposure to saltwater is a daily circumstance, the durability of galvanized washers is indispensable. Given their ability to withstand harsh environmental conditions, they offer an unparalleled advantage over non-treated steel washers, which are susceptible to rust and decay.

Real-world applications demonstrate the undeniable practicality and efficacy of galvanized washers. In residential construction, for instance, galvanized washers are a staple in framing and decking, giving homeowners confidence in the robustness and longevity of their structures. In the automobile industry, they are utilized in areas prone to moisture exposure, protecting vital mechanical components from the detrimental effects of rust. These practical applications highlight the distinct advantages of choosing galvanized washers, reinforcing their status as a trusted solution for resisting nature's corrosive forces.
